Waffle coin enthusiasts take note: Numismatic Enterprises, Inc., has just released the Waffled Kennedy half dollar for sale nationwide.

Like other waffle coins, the Waffled Kennedy is a coin that the U.S. Mint deemed unfit for circulation due to a mistake or imperfection in the minting process, resulting in waffle cancellation by the Mint.

The Waffled Kennedy half dollar joins the Maine and Missouri waffled quarters as the only waffled coins released from the Philadelphia Waffle Hoard and certified to come directly from the U.S. Mint.

Each waffle coin is sonically sealed with a picture of the coin and a full description of the waffling process. They are housed in plastic holders produced by Global Certification Services, Inc.

In addition, the coin grading company Global Certification Services certifies that each waffle coin in the GCS holder came directly from the Mint.

The U.S. Mint has indicated that it will no longer allow waffle coins to be released, so supplies of each waffle coin are limited.
